Atraksi paling populer di Poland

Things to do in Poland include exploring the historic Wawel Castle in Krakow, a royal residence featuring stunning Renaissance architecture. Visit the Auschwitz-Birkenau State Museum to understand profound World War II history. Stroll through Old Town Market Square in Warsaw, known for its colorful buildings and lively atmosphere, perfect for soaking in local culture.

1. Wawel Castle

Krakow

4.7 (163,343)
MuseumCastleTempat bersejarahAtraksi wisataTempat menarik

Experience a royal adventure filled with centuries-old art and tales of fire-breathing dragons. Walk through grand halls and watch the dragon breathe fire in a spectacular show.

Fakta cepat: The castle's royal chambers house an extensive collection of medieval tapestries, some over 500 years old. A legendary dragon sculpture near the entrance breathes real flames, capturing everyone's attention instantly.

Sorotan: Deep in the castle's chapels, visitors find a unique fresco by famous Renaissance artist Bartolommeo Berrecci, vivid with 16th-century humor and symbolism. The dragon statue, designed to exhale fire every few minutes, provides a thrilling spectacle especially at dusk.

2. Auschwitz-Birkenau State Museum

Oswiecim

4.8 (3,852)
Atraksi wisataHistory MuseumLandmark bersejarahTempat bersejarahMuseum

Powerful journey into history's darkest period. Experience raw ruins, personal artifacts, and haunting stories that linger long after visiting.

Fakta cepat: More than 1.1 million people, mostly Jews, were murdered at this site during World War II. It covers 191 hectares with original barracks, watchtowers, and gas chambers preserved as somber reminders.

Sorotan: Walking through the gate with the chilling sign 'Arbeit Macht Frei' reveals authentic prisoner graffiti and personal belongings displayed in glass cases. The vastness of the grounds paired with survivor testimonies creates an unforgettable emotional experience.

3. Old Town Market Square

Warsaw

4.6 (2,552)
Landmark bersejarahTempat bersejarahTempat menarikTempat

Fakta cepat: Bayangan dari fasad berwarna-warni dan suara denting gelas kafe mengisi alun-alun, di mana musisi jalanan dan pelukis mengubah sudut batu kali menjadi kartu pos hidup. Di bawah permukaan, rekonstruksi pascaperang yang teliti menggunakan bata bekas dan gambar arsip untuk menghidupkan kembali detail bersejarah, mengejutkan banyak orang yang mengharapkan jalanan abad pertengahan yang utuh.

Sorotan: Setelah kehancuran pada tahun 1944, para restorator banyak mengacu pada lukisan Canaletto abad ke-18 karya Bernardo Bellotto untuk membangun kembali fasad yang dilukis, menggandakan detail kecil seperti moldings jendela dan palet warna merah sinabar, oker pucat, dan teal lembut. Pada malam hari yang hangat kamu dapat mendengar suara batu kali di bawah kaki dan mencium aroma roti jahe panggang dengan rempah kayu manis dan pala, sementara bekas peluru perang masih berkilau samar di bawah sinar matahari sebagai bekas luka yang terlihat.

4. Malbork Castle

Malbork

4.8 (81,011)
CastleAtraksi wisataTempat bersejarahMuseumTempat menarik

Explore the largest brick castle on the planet with centuries of knightly history. Walk through towering walls and grand halls that bring medieval life to vivid detail.

Fakta cepat: An immense fortress complex spans over 21 hectares, making it the largest brick castle in the world. Its walls are over 5 meters thick in some places, designed for robust medieval defense.

Sorotan: The castle’s High Castle houses a stunning Great Refectory with a medieval dining table over 30 meters long, where the Teutonic Knights once feasted. Visitors can witness the deep red bricks glowing warmly under the soft glow of flickering torchlight recreations during special tours.

5. Bialowieza Forest

Bialowieza

4.6 (1,152)
WoodsFitur alamTempat

Step into one of Europe's last primeval forests where ancient trees and wild bison roam free. Encounter untamed nature and rare wildlife in an awe-inspiring natural sanctuary.

Fakta cepat: The forest is one of the last and largest remnants of the primeval forest that once stretched across the European Plain. It shelters over 800 European bison, the continent's heaviest land mammal, roaming freely in its dense woods.

Sorotan: Look closely and you might spot the elusive Eurasian lynx or catch the giant bison crossing a misty clearing at dawn. The forest's untouched nature includes ancient trees over 500 years old, some with hollow trunks that house rare insects and owls.

6. Wieliczka Salt Mine

Wieliczka

4.6 (31,990)
Tempat bersejarahAtraksi wisataLandmark bersejarahMuseumTempat menarik

Fakta cepat: Visitors often describe a hush and a cool mineral tang in the air as chandeliers and sculptures carved from salt shimmer under torchlight. A chapel carved entirely from salt hosts concerts, and an underground labyrinth of passages stretches for more than 300 kilometers beneath the surface.

Sorotan: Beneath the surface lie roughly 287 kilometers of tunnels, including a cathedral-sized chapel where chandeliers made of crystalline salt glitter like frosted amber. Legend says Princess Kinga tossed her engagement ring into a Hungarian shaft, and miners later found that exact ring encased in a salt lump used to decorate St. Kinga's Chapel, a story still told during the miners' Saint Barbara celebrations on December 4.

7. St. Mary's Basilica

Krakow

4.8 (18,856)
Atraksi wisataGerejaTempat ibadahTempat menarikAssociation Or Organization

Fakta cepat: A sudden, piercing five-note trumpet call cuts across the square every hour from the taller tower, halting mid-melody to honor a legendary trumpeter. Inside, a colossal Gothic wooden altarpiece dominates the chancel, its hundreds of carved figures and restored polychrome still making many visitors gasp.

Sorotan: The colossal Gothic altarpiece carved by Veit Stoss between 1477 and 1489 rises about 13 meters, its lacquered oak figures glowing with cracked gold leaf and the faint scent of centuries-old beeswax when you lean in close. Each hour a lone trumpeter plays the hejnał from the highest tower and deliberately stops mid-melody to honor the 1241 trumpeter who, legend says, was shot in the throat while sounding the alarm.

8. Tatra Mountains

Zakopane

4.8 (2,174)
Fitur alamTempat

Stunning alpine landscapes await with towering peaks and crystal-clear lakes. Experience crisp air, wild fauna, and scenic trails for unforgettable mountain adventures.

Fakta cepat: The Tatra Mountains form the highest range of the Carpathians, stretching over 50 kilometers along the Poland-Slovakia border. Glacial valleys and sharp peaks rise dramatically, including Rysy, the highest peak in Poland at 2,499 meters.

Sorotan: A unique natural feature is the Morskie Oko lake, shimmering emerald-green and surrounded by jagged cliffs, accessible by a popular 9-kilometer trail. You can spot chamois and marmots, mountain animals rarely seen elsewhere in Poland's forests.

Hidangan manis tradisional

Pączki

Pączki

Pączki are Polish doughnuts filled with sweet fillings like rose jam or plum butter, traditionally enjoyed on Fat Thursday before Lent begins. They are celebrated for their light, fluffy texture and rich fillings.

Sernik

Sernik

Sernik is a classic Polish cheesecake made with twaróg, a type of curd cheese, giving it a unique texture and flavor different from American cheesecakes.

Makowiec

Makowiec

Makowiec is a poppy seed roll that features a sweet yeast dough rolled with a dense, flavorful filling of ground poppy seeds often mixed with nuts, honey and dried fruits.

Hidangan gurih tradisional

Pierogi

Pierogi

Pierogi are Polish dumplings that can be filled with a variety of ingredients including potatoes, cheese, meat, and fruits, making them versatile and beloved in Polish cuisine.

Bigos

Bigos

Bigos, known as hunter's stew, is a hearty dish made from sauerkraut, fresh cabbage, and various meats, often simmered for days to deepen its rich, smoky flavor.

Żurek

Żurek

Żurek is a traditional sour rye soup seasoned with garlic and marjoram, typically served with sausage and boiled eggs, especially popular during Easter.

Minuman tradisional

Kompot

Kompot

Kompot is a traditional Polish fruit drink made by boiling fresh or dried fruits in water with sugar, enjoyed both hot and cold.

Krupnik

Krupnik

Krupnik is a sweet Polish honey liqueur infused with a blend of spices, known for its warming properties and rich, smooth taste.

Nalewka

Nalewka

Nalewka refers to a variety of homemade Polish fruit and herb infusions, often made by steeping fruits or herbs in vodka or spirit for several weeks to develop complex flavors.

Frequently Asked Questions about Poland

Is Poland safe for tourists?
Poland is generally safe for tourists, with low crime rates compared to other European countries. Petty crimes like pickpocketing can occur, especially in crowded areas, so travelers should stay vigilant. Emergency services are reliable, and major cities have good police presence.
How many days should I spend in Poland?
A typical visit to Poland lasts between 7 to 10 days. This allows time to see major cities such as Warsaw, Krakow, and Gdansk, as well as explore countryside areas like the Tatra Mountains or Masurian Lakes. Longer stays enable deeper cultural experiences.
What is the best time to visit Poland?
The best time to visit Poland is from May to September. During these months, temperatures range from 15°C to 25°C, ideal for sightseeing and outdoor activities. Summers are warm and pleasant, while spring and early autumn provide fewer tourists and mild weather.
Is Poland expensive for travelers?
Poland is considered affordable for travelers. A meal at an inexpensive restaurant typically costs around 20-30 PLN (5-7 USD), and local transport fares are about 4-6 PLN per ride. Accommodation ranges from budget hostels to mid-range hotels costing approximately 100-250 PLN per night.
How to get around Poland?
Getting around Poland is convenient with an extensive and affordable transport network. Trains connect major cities with fares around 30-100 PLN. Buses cover regional travel, while cities offer tram and bus services. Renting a car is possible but not necessary for typical tourist routes.
